  • Patent number: 11715023
    Abstract: The present disclosure relates to a concept for training one or more model parameters of a predictive parking difficulty model for different locations based on collected telemetry data. A ground truth ranking related to subjective parking difficulties at the different locations is obtained based on pairwise comparison of parking difficulties between pairs of the different locations by one or more humans. A prediction loss between a model ranking of the different locations obtained by the predictive parking difficulty model and the ground truth ranking is determined. The one or more model parameters are adjusted to minimize the prediction loss between the model ranking and the ground truth ranking.

  • Patent number: 10317241
    Abstract: A navigation system includes primary and secondary navigation device, and a server. The secondary navigation device transmits geolocation data to the server. The primary navigation device receives user input indicating a destination. The primary navigation device also determines a current route to the destination based on a current location of the primary navigation device, and transmits the current route to the server. The primary navigation device also receives and displays a difficulty index from the server in response to transmitting the current route. The server determines historical routes reflecting historical commutes based on the geolocation data. The server also determines the difficulty index based on the one or more historical routes and the current route, and transmits the difficulty index to the primary navigation device in response to receiving the current route.

  • Publication number: 20080091427
    Abstract: Systems and methods are provided for compressing data models, for example, N-gram language models used in speech recognition applications. Words in the vocabulary of the language model are assigned to classes of words, for example, by syntactic criteria, semantic criteria, or statistical analysis of an existing language model. After word classes are defined, the follower lists for words in the vocabulary may be stored as hierarchical sets of class indexes and word indexes within each class. Hierarchical word indexes may reduce the storage requirements for the N-gram language model by more efficiently representing multiple words in a single list in the same follower list.

  • Publication number: 20070078653
    Abstract: A method for compressing a language model that comprises a plurality of N-grams and associated N-gram probabilities. The method comprises forming at least one group of N-grams from the plurality of N-grams; sorting N-gram probabilities associated with the N-grams of the at least one group of N-grams; and determining a compressed representation of the sorted N-gram probabilities. The at least one group of N-grams may be formed from N-grams of the plurality of N-grams that are conditioned on the same (N?1)-tuple of preceding words. The compressed representation of the sorted N-gram probabilities may be a sampled representation of the sorted N-gram probabilities or may comprise an index into a codebook. The invention further relates to an according computer program product and device, to a storage medium for at least partially storing a language model, and to a device for processing data at least partially based on a language model.

  • Publication number: 20070021729
    Abstract: The present invention relates to a packing for an infusion set. The infusion set for intermittent or continuous administration of a therapeutic substance, such as insulin, includes an infusion part having a cannula penetrating the skin of a patient and a connector which connects the infusion part with a medical device such as an adaptor for a syringe or an insulin pump. The insertion of the infusion part will be performed with an insertion needle which is delivered together with the infusion part under sterile conditions. The packaging includes an impenetrable part protecting the surroundings from the insertion needle and a removal part which is to be removed by the user before applying the infusion part. The inner surface of the impenetrable part is provided with a retainer for releasable retaining at least a part of the infusion set.
